Confirmations and Commitments of Faith: November and December 

As the end of the year draws closer and we get ready to celebrate the birth of Christ, the final baptisms, confirmations, and commitments of faith for 2023, have taken place around the diocese.
Our Bishops travelled the length and breadth of the diocese during the year, joining our worshipping communities in prayer, praise, and celebration.

During November, Bishop Martyn joined the congregation of St Peter’s Church in Glenfield to baptise George and confirm Karen, Peter, Kathryn and Chloe.
Addressing each candidate by name, the Bishop anointed them with oil and prayed for their continued journeys in faith. Those confirmed also shared their faith stories.  

Later in the month, Bishop Roger Jupp and Fr Andrew Lee, led a celebratory service of confirmation at St Hugh’s Church in Eyres Monsell.
Philippa, Reuben, Nicholas and Kevin from St Hugh’s, and Andrew and Mitchell from St James the Greater in Huncote, made their commitment in front of their church, family, and friends.


Most recently, in early December, Bishop Saju visited St Edward’s Church in Castle Donington where he confirmed Steve, Mary and Dawn, and honoured the reaffirmation of Janet and Richard’s confirmation promises.The candidates, from both St Botolph’s Church in Shepshed and St Edward’s, received the light of Christ and shared in a celebratory cake, cut by Bishop Saju, following the service.
